Job SummaryThe RN Oncology Infusion Therapy Clinician functions under the direction of the Manager Infusion Therapy or other designated leader. The RN Oncology Infusion Therapy Clinician demonstrates knowledge, competency, and clinical expertise in oncology infusion therapy including but not limited to hazardous drug therapies for treating malignant and nonmalignant conditions. This RN will regularly administer chemotherapy, immunotherapy, antineoplastics agents, hazardous drugs, and targeted therapies.
The RN works in an outpatient infusion center; alternate settings may occur. The RN is responsible for providing safe patient care with an understanding and awareness of age‑appropriate and culturally aware needs, addressing patient/family biological, emotional, developmental, psychosocial, and educational needs, and delivering patient care in complex situations. The RN serves as a clinical resource to nursing staff, operational leadership, and medical staff.
All RNs are licensed, knowledgeable, and uphold the practice of nursing as outlined by the Georgia Professional Nurse Practice Act and the American Nurses Association. The RN is expected to attend staff meetings, in‑services, special projects, and continued education, and may serve as a preceptor for newly hired RN colleagues. Local travel is required.
